Fertilizing is a critical part of successful gardening and agriculture. It ensures that plants receive the essential nutrients they need to grow healthy and vibrant. Among the various forms of fertilizer, granulated fertilizers have become increasingly popular due to their ease of application, controlled nutrient release, and versatility. However, with so many options available, choosing the right granulated fertilizer can be overwhelming. This article will guide you through understanding granulated fertilizers, their benefits, types, and how to select the best one for your plants.
Understanding Granulated Fertilizers
Granulated fertilizers are solid nutrient sources composed of small, dry particles or granules that contain essential plant nutrients like nitrogen (N), phosphorus (P), and potassium (K), as well as secondary and micronutrients. Unlike liquid fertilizers, granules are usually applied directly to the soil or mixed in with potting media.
The granules dissolve slowly over time with the help of soil moisture, releasing nutrients gradually to the plant roots. This slow-release feature helps maintain nutrient levels in the soil over an extended period, reducing the risk of nutrient leaching and minimizing the need for frequent applications.
Benefits of Using Granulated Fertilizers
Choosing granulated fertilizers offers several advantages for both home gardeners and commercial growers:
1. Controlled Nutrient Release
Many granulated fertilizers are formulated as slow-release or controlled-release products. They dissolve gradually, providing a steady supply of nutrients and preventing sudden spikes that could harm plants or cause nutrient runoff.
2. Ease of Application
Granules are easy to apply evenly across garden beds or lawns using a spreader or by hand. They do not require mixing like some liquid fertilizers and can be stored conveniently without spilling or leaking.
3. Reduced Frequency of Fertilizing
Because granules release nutrients slowly over weeks or months, gardeners don’t need to fertilize as often compared to water-soluble fertilizers. This saves time and reduces labor costs in commercial settings.
4. Less Risk of Plant Burn
Liquid fertilizers can sometimes cause “fertilizer burn,” damaging plant roots if applied too concentratedly. Granulated forms reduce this risk due to their gradual nutrient release.
5. Versatility
Granulated fertilizers come in many formulations tailored for specific plants, soil types, or growth stages, making them highly adaptable to different gardening needs.
Types of Granulated Fertilizers
Not all granulated fertilizers are created equal; they vary based on nutrient content, release mechanisms, and additional ingredients. Understanding these types will help you make an informed choice.
1. Complete vs. Incomplete Fertilizers
-
Complete fertilizers contain all three primary macronutrients—N-P-K—in balanced proportions suitable for general plant health.
-
Incomplete fertilizers provide only one or two primary nutrients and may be used for specific deficiencies or particular plant requirements.
2. Slow-Release Fertilizers
Slow-release granules often have a coating — such as sulfur-coated urea or polymer-coated formulations — that slows down nutrient dissolution. These products provide nutrients over several weeks to months depending on temperature and moisture conditions.
Advantages:
– Fewer applications needed
– Reduced leaching risk
– Better nutrient use efficiency
3. Water-Soluble Granules
These fertilizers dissolve quickly when added to water, making them useful for fertigation (fertilizer application with irrigation) or foliar feeding when mixed in spray solutions. Although technically granular, they act more like liquid fertilizers once dissolved.
Advantages:
– Rapid nutrient availability
– Useful for quick correction of deficiencies
4. Organic vs. Synthetic Granular Fertilizers
-
Organic granulated fertilizers are derived from natural sources such as bone meal, blood meal, fish emulsion pellets, composted manures, or seaweed extracts.
-
Synthetic granulated fertilizers are chemically manufactured with precise N-P-K ratios.
Organic options improve soil health by enhancing microbial activity and adding organic matter but typically release nutrients more slowly and less predictably than synthetic types.
Synthetic granules provide fast and reliable nutrient availability but may not contribute to soil structure improvements.
How to Choose the Right Granulated Fertilizer
Selecting an appropriate fertilizer depends on various factors including your plant type, soil conditions, growth stage, and environmental considerations.
1. Identify Your Plant’s Nutrient Requirements
Different plants have varying nutritional needs:
- Leafy vegetables often require higher nitrogen for lush foliage.
- Flowering plants may benefit from increased phosphorus and potassium for blooms.
- Fruit-bearing plants need balanced N-P-K for overall health and fruit development.
Consult plant-specific guidelines or seed packet recommendations to determine suitable N-P-K ratios.
2. Test Your Soil Before Applying Fertilizer
A soil test provides vital information on existing nutrient levels, pH balance, and organic matter content. This data helps you avoid over-fertilizing or under-supplying nutrients.
Soil tests can be done through local agricultural extensions or commercial labs. The results typically suggest which nutrients are deficient and recommend fertilizer formulations accordingly.
3. Consider the Release Rate
- For long-term crops like trees or shrubs requiring steady nutrition over months, slow-release granules are ideal.
- For short-season annuals or rapid growth phases needing immediate nutrition, water-soluble granules may be preferable.
Also consider climate; in cooler conditions slow-release products may not break down quickly enough whereas hotter climates accelerate nutrient release.
4. Evaluate Nutrient Ratios (N-P-K)
Understand what each element does:
- Nitrogen (N): Promotes leaf growth
- Phosphorus (P): Supports root development and flowering
- Potassium (K): Enhances disease resistance and overall vigor
Choose a balanced formula unless your soil test indicates deficiencies in specific nutrients requiring customized blends.
5. Organic vs Synthetic Considerations
If your priority is sustainable gardening with enhanced soil health, opt for organic granulated fertilizers even if they release nutrients slower.
For high-yield vegetable production demanding precise nutrition control – synthetic formulations may deliver better results.
Many gardeners blend both types to enjoy quick growth boosts alongside improved soil structure long term.
6. Application Method Compatibility
Ensure the fertilizer you pick matches your application plan:
- Hand-spreading around individual plants?
- Using a broadcast spreader on lawns or large beds?
- Mixing into potting mix for container plants?
Some slow-release pellets crumble easily which helps with mixing; others retain shape better for spreading accuracy.
7. Environmental Impact
Choose environmentally friendly products that minimize runoff pollution risks:
- Slow-release coatings reduce leaching into groundwater.
- Organic sources improve soil microbes instead of relying solely on chemicals.
Avoid over-fertilizing since excess nutrients contribute significantly to waterway contamination problems like algal blooms.
Common Granulated Fertilizer Products
Here are examples of popular categories you might find at garden centers:
-
All-purpose NPK blends: Typically something like 10-10-10 or 14-14-14 good for general garden use.
-
Lawn fertilizers: Often higher nitrogen content such as 24-4-12 designed specifically for turfgrass growth.
-
Tomato-specific formulas: Balanced but slightly higher potassium to encourage fruiting.
-
Organic bone meal: High in phosphorus; great for flowering bulbs and root crops.
-
Sulfur-coated urea: A classic slow-release nitrogen source providing months-long feeding cycles.
Always read product labels carefully to confirm nutrient content and instructions before buying.
How to Apply Granulated Fertilizer Properly
Even the best fertilizer won’t work effectively if misapplied:
- Measure accurately: Follow recommended rates based on area size or number of plants.
- Distribute evenly: Use a spreader or hand scatter uniformly avoiding clumps.
- Incorporate into soil: Lightly rake or water after applying so nutrients reach root zones.
- Avoid direct contact with stems/leaves: To prevent burning sensitive tissues.
- Time applications wisely: Early growing season is usually ideal; avoid late-season fertilization that promotes unwanted growth before dormancy.
